Archbishop Chaput of Denver has written a great little essay about the difference between Christmas and Xmas. Excerpt:

The world has an ingenious ability to attach itself to what Christians believe; tame it, subvert it, and then turn it against the very people who continue to believe. Too many Americans don't really celebrate Christmas. They may think they do, but they don't. They celebrate Exmas.
